  • Publication number: 20250051229
    Abstract: The invention relates to a method for producing an aggregate comprising the steps of providing a starting product comprising at least 20% by mass magnesium silicate hydrate, crushing to a fineness corresponding to a BET surface area of 0.1 m2/g or finer, homogenizing the starting product, and at least partially dewatering the starting product of bound water by means of thermal treatment in a thermal treatment unit, contacting the dewatered starting product with CO2, wherein CO2 reacts with the dewatered magnesium silicate hydrate and the CO2 is bound in the resulting magnesium carbonate hydrate and/or magnesium carbonate, and compressing and compacting the dewatered starting product before or after contacting with CO2 to solids for producing the aggregate. The invention also relates to an aggregate.

  • Publication number: 20250042813
    Abstract: The invention relates to a composite material that makes use of cement stone of a MgO- and/or olivine-based binder and reinforcing elements for increasing the load-bearing capacity, wherein the reinforcing elements are resistant to pH values of less than 11 and/or have a protection against pH values of less than 11. Additionally or alternatively, agents for raising the pH value of the pore solution of the cement stone can be added to the MgO- and/or olivine-based binder of the cement stone.

  • Publication number: 20250042756
    Abstract: The invention relates to a method for sequestering CO2, which comprises the steps of providing a starting product comprising at least 20% by mass of one or more of the following components, ultramafic rocks, weathering products of ultramafic rocks, olivine and/or industrial waste materials, homogenizing the starting product and hydro-thermally treating the homogenized starting product in a heat treatment apparatus at a temperature of above 100° C. for at least 24 hours. Furthermore, the converted starting product is dewatered of bound water by means of thermal treatment and/or reaction grinding. Subsequently, the product thus obtained is contacted with CO2, wherein the latter is bound.

  • Publication number: 20180305253
    Abstract: The invention relates to a method for producing cements by hydrothermally treating a starting material containing sources of CaO and SiO2 in an autoclave at a temperature of 100 to 300° C., and tempering the obtained intermediate product at 350 to 700° C., wherein water formed during tempering is dissipated by grinding the intermediate product and/or tempering taking place under a continuous gas stream. The invention also relates to cements obtained in this manner, hydraulic binders therefrom, and building materials which contain said binders.

  • Publication number: 20180305254
    Abstract: Activators for supplementary cementitious material, comprising reactive belite, obtainable by hydrothermal treatment of a starting material, which contains sources for CaO and SiO2 in an autoclave at a temperature of 100 to 300° C. and tempering the obtained intermediate product at 350 to 495° C., hydraulic binders based on the supplementary cementitious material above, and by a method for activating the supplementary cementitious material by adding reactive belite obtainable by hydrothermal treatment of a starting material which contains sources for CaO and SiO2 in an autoclave at a temperature of 100 to 300° C. and tempering the obtained intermediate product at 350 to 495° C. and the use of the reactive belite containing material as activator.
